At the beginning of each school day, prayers that are written by our students are read over the loudspeaker as we begin our daily journey together. Throughout the day, our students are encouraged to enjoy a variety of activities. Students may choose to participate in academic contests, depending on their grade level, such as the Geography Bee and the Spelling Bee, Quiz Bowl, Math Counts, Science Olympiad, and Battle of the Books. We also encourage our students to enjoy discovering their artistic talents by providing them with opportunities such as the Star Singers, Art Fairs, Christmas Pageants, and the 6th grade and 8th grade plays.
We encourage students to get involved in their school and to take action. Our students actively take part in Christian service opportunities for the school and the greater community. Our junior high students get involved through student council and through mentoring opportunities as they help guide our younger students, whether it’s by sitting with them in Mass or by lending an ear as they practice their reading out loud.
